Illustration
Illustration

API як інструмент поєднання різних систем

    icon
    05.01.2023
    icon
    14 хвилин
    icon
    Автор: Vadym Zamoroka
Illustration

API як інструмент поєднання різних систем

    icon
    05.01.2023
    icon
    14 хвилин
    icon
    Автор: Vadym Zamoroka

Термін API розшифровується як «application programing interface», тобто це функціонал, який дозволяє двом або більше програмам обмінюватися даними або ж повідомленнями одна з одною. API можна розглянути, як свого роду віртуальний інтерфейс взаємодії, щоб вводити/читати дані або надсилати/отримувати дані. До веб-інтерфейсів API можна легко отримати доступ через Інтернет.

Що саме являє собою API інтеграція?

Інтеграція API — це процес встановлення безпечного, надійного та ефективного з’єднання між API двох програм. За допомогою цього вони можуть спілкуватися один з одним і обмінюватися даними. Інтеграція дозволяє компаніям використовувати дані з кількох програм для покращення функціональності власних бізнес-процесів. Включення передових і більш функціональних технологій у вже наявному пакеті технологій бізнесу дозволяє розширити можливості внутрішніх робочих процесів і клієнтського досвіду.

Необхідність інтеграції API не можна ігнорувати, особливо якщо компанія має справу з хмарними програмами та інструментами. Він формує основу зв’язку між хмарними програмами та іншими системами в процесі.

Ось ще кілька причин, чому інтеграція даних API важлива:

Причина 1. СТАБІЛЬНЕ З’ЄДНАННЯ МІЖ КІЛЬКОМА ПРОГРАМАМИ ТА СИСТЕМАМИ

Незалежно від того, які програми та системи використовуються в організації, усі вони повинні спілкуватися одна з одною, щоб підтримувати синхронізацію між собою. Така синхронізація встановлюється за допомогою інтеграції API.

ПРИЧИНА 2. РІВЕНЬ ПРОДУКТИВНОСТІ КОМАНДИ ПІДВИЩУЄТЬСЯ:

Інтеграція API підвищує продуктивність команди, оскільки знімає з розробників необхідність вручну інтегрувати програми. Розробники можуть бути готові виконувати більш важливі завдання, а не встановлювати з’єднання та підтримувати API. Крім того, такі інтеграції мають можливість залучати нетехнічний персонал до створення та керування власними API.

ПРИЧИНА 3. ЛЕГКЕ СТВОРЕННЯ НОВИХ ПІДКЛЮЧЕНЬ API:

Раніше створення нових API обмежувалося використанням доступних опцій або створенням нових з нуля. Перший варіант надає обмежену функціональність і практично не контролює його роботу. Другий варіант – трудомісткий, дорогий і ресурсозатратний. Ви можете порахувати, скільки разів вам знадобиться створювати API, щоб дозволити вашим програмам доступ до нових даних. Однак із платформами інтеграції API створити новий API не складає проблем. Немає потреби в додаткових інвестиціях. Ви можете створити новий API, використовуючи наявну інтеграцію через платформу інтеграції.

Підтримуючи синхронізацію даних у всіх підключених системах, продуктивність підвищується, тож ви можете використовувати ці дані для підвищення ефективності та збільшення прибутку.

4 способи використання інтеграції API:

Від додатків і даних до бізнес-екосистем, API швидко стають опорою в більшості корпоративних стратегій інтеграції. Ось лише чотири з незліченних способів, якими ваш бізнес може почати використовувати API для полегшення інтеграцій.

спосіб 1. API для конфігурації, адміністрування та моніторингу продуктів

Цей тип API дозволяє вам виконувати будь-які типи адміністрування вашої хмари, які ви можете виконувати через адміністративний графічний інтерфейс. Ви можете запустити систему автономії та керувати нею без необхідності підходити до клавіатури та буквально торкатися чогось. Усі функції керування даними доступні сьогодні через REST API. Існують обмежені можливості для керування перекладом або трансформацією через API, але частина цього полягає в тому, що трансформація є автономною, тому студія та середовище виконання розділені. Таким чином, багато в чому, попри наявність можливостей, залишаються деякі прогалини, які також потрібно заповнити.

спосіб 2. API для завантаження файлів

Якщо ви подивитеся на можливості переміщення даних, зазвичай ви почнете з кількох безпечних протоколів зв’язку. Ці протоколи використовуються для інтеграції на основі файлів і включають FTP, SFTP, AS2, а також, як часто буває, безпечний портал для потоків файлів від людини до системи. Якщо ви хочете завантажити файл, ви можете використовувати для цього REST API, а також допоміжні API, які можна налаштувати для програмного завантаження та завантаження файлів на платформу інтеграції та з неї. Ці типи API стосуються того, як компанія може працювати в рамках традиційного переміщення даних і підтримувати різноманітні та гнучкі сценарії інтеграції на основі файлів у своєму середовищі.

спосіб 3. Використання інструментів для з’єднання інших систем за допомогою їхніх API

Третій приклад стосується API, які надаються іншими системами, а не власними. Деякі з найпопулярніших прикладів базових корпоративних систем включають Zoho One, Pipedrive, Odoo та інші. У цьому випадку ці системи представляють ці API, що дозволяє компанії використовувати їх (API) для інтеграцій на основі додатків.

спосіб 4. Використання хмарної інфраструктури API для використання іншими системами

Четвертий і останній приклад фактично є іншою стороною попереднього прикладу, де підприємство використовуватиме API системи. Тут підприємство представляє API для доступу іншим. Наприклад, надання API для замовлення продуктів. Хтось у Zoho One хоче, щоб хтось мав доступ до їхнього середовища, щоб міг виконувати операції за допомогою програми через їхні API.

Додаткові переваги інтеграції API:

Як бачите, інтеграція API надає багато цінних переваг для вашого бізнесу в цілому, але занурюючись трохи глибше, у чому ще може допомогти інтеграція API?

Десятиліттями інтеграція була одним із найскладніших, спеціалізованих і неприємних завдань у світі ІТ. API полегшують інтеграцію, спрощуючи підключення, переміщення та перетворення даних. Завдяки можливості різних систем або програм для співпраці та безперешкодного обміну інформацією всі ваші бізнес-процеси стають швидкими й автономними.

Виконання завдань вручну є громіздким і трудомістким. Автоматизація рутинних завдань за допомогою інтеграції API — це надійний спосіб полегшити ваше життя.

Підсумок

ЯКЩО КОРОТКО ПІДСУМУВАТИ, ТО МАЄМО ТАКІ ОСНОВНІ ПЕРЕВАГИ ІНТЕГРАЦІЇ API, І НАЙБІЛЬШ ПОМІТНІ З НИХ ЦЕ:

ПЕРЕВАГА 1. Автоматизація

Інтеграція API дає можливість автоматично передавати інформацію та дані від однієї програми до іншої. Успішна автоматизація допомагає усунути людський фактор, що економить час і значно зменшує кількість помилок.

ПЕРЕВАГА 2. Масштабованість

Інтеграція API дозволяє підприємствам розвиватися, оскільки їм не потрібно починати з нуля, створюючи підключені системи та програми.

ПЕРЕВАГА 3. Спрощена видимість/комунікація/звітність

Інтеграція API дозволяє наскрізну видимість усіх систем і процесів для покращення зв’язку та звітності. Завдяки спрощеному підходу ви можете ефективно відстежувати та контролювати дані, створюючи таким чином надійні звіти на основі конкретних і вичерпних пакетів даних.

ПЕРЕВАГА 4. Зменшує кількість помилок

Інтеграція API дозволяє передавати складні та об’ємні дані з меншою кількістю помилок і невідповідностей.

АРІ інтеграції 

АРІ інтеграції дуже важливі для ведення свого бізнесу, і не важливо він великий чи маленький, тому що при побудові власного API інтерфейсу маленький бізнес може перетворитись у великий за короткий час. Уявіть, що ви маленька кредитна спілка, яка надає грошові позики й ви побудували API інтерфейс для своєї CRM і свого сайту/лендінгу. Це дає вам змогу співпрацювати із різними лідогенераторами, які нададуть вам потік лідів/клієнтів, яких потрібно обробляти. Відповідно, по API інтеграції ви автоматично зможете відправляти у відповідь лідогенератору статуси обробки й комісію за них, не витрачаючи на це додатковий дорогоцінний час який краще приділити обробці лідів. І це тільки один з дрібних прикладів можливості API інтеграції.

Ми, компанія AlterEGO займаємось API інтеграціями вже понад 10 років. Інтеграції виконували як і великим бізнесам (мережі аптек, кредитним установам, інтернет-магазинам) так і маленьким бізнесам, де були потрібні дрібні інтеграції (для прикладу: передача тегу між Pipedrive CRM і CloudTalk (кол-центр), де стандартна інтеграція й інтеграція через Zapier (сервіс який пов'язує різні сервіси, не використовуючи розробки) не надавали такої можливості по передачі даного поля.

Інтеграція API є невіддільною частиною цифрової ери. Підприємства, що процвітають, вже користуються різноманітними перевагами інтеграції. Тому вам також слід розглянути це, якщо ви бажаєте перевершити своїх конкурентів.

Якщо ви хочете дізнатися більше про інтеграцію REST API або ж ви потребуєте інтегрувати вашу CRM з вашим сайтом чи будь-які інші системи, зв’яжіться з нами й ми обговоримо ваш бізнес-процес та почнемо робити ваш бізнес швидшим, диджиталізованим і автономним.

Illustration

ЮЛІЯ АНДРУСЯК

Акаунт-директор

+38 050 700 75 72

latigid.ogeretla%40kaysurdna.y

Обговоримо завдання вашого бізнесу та знайдемо оптимальне рішення.

Бронюйте консультацію

Об’єднаємо зусилля заради великих результатів?

Дякуємо!

Ми зв'яжемося з вами найближчим часом

Can't send form.

Please try again later.